News Summary

American Cruise Lines is launching an array of exciting Extended Cruises in 2026, celebrating the 250th birthday of the United States. Notable itineraries include ‘The Great United States Cruise 2026,’ spanning 52 days from Portland to Boston, ‘Spring Across America 2026,’ a 51-day journey from Charleston to Juneau, and ‘Great American Fall Foliage Cruise 2026.’ These cruises promise a mix of adventure, culture, and stunning landscapes across various states and national parks.

Unveiling the “Great United States Cruise 2026”

First on the list is the magnificent “The Great United States Cruise 2026.” Spanning a whopping 52 days, this journey will kick off in Portland, Oregon, and glide all the way to Boston, Massachusetts, from May 29 to July 19, 2026. Talk about a summertime adventure! Strap in for a whirlwind tour across 18 states, with exciting stops at three magnificent national parks: Yellowstone, Glacier, and Grand Teton. This isn’t just a cruise; it’s a deep dive into America’s stunning landscapes.

During this voyage, travelers will cruise through both the scenic Columbia and Snake Rivers as well as the legendary Mississippi River. A highlight of this itinerary is the chance to celebrate the July 4th holiday in none other than Boston, where you can witness spectacular fireworks illuminating the sky over Boston Harbor as a part of the nation’s birthday celebrations. Spring into Adventure with the “Spring Across America 2026”

If you’re more of a springtime explorer, then consider hopping on the “Spring Across America 2026.” This enchanting 51-day cruise will set sail from Charleston, South Carolina, to Juneau, Alaska, between April 3 and May 23, 2026. This journey will cover 10 states and feature breathtaking ports of call such as the mesmerizing Dry Tortugas National Park. Along the way, you’ll cruise the picturesque Gulf Coast and Lower Mississippi River, giving you stunning views that you won’t soon forget.

And what’s a trip to Alaska without immersing yourself in its beauty? Prepare yourself for an incredible trek through the Inside Passage, topped off with a visit to the splendid Glacier Bay National Park. Don’t forget your camera – you’re going to want to capture those awe-inspiring views!

Prepare for Stunning Foliage on the “Great American Fall Foliage Cruise 2026”

Feeling like you need to experience a fantastic fall? Then the “Great American Fall Foliage Cruise 2026” might just be calling your name! This 55-day journey will take you from Juneau to Washington, D.C., running from September 5 to October 29, 2026. This adventure boasts visits to 18 states and will showcase some of the most vibrant fall colors you have ever seen. You’ll get to take in notable locations in Alaska, scenic views along the Columbia and Snake Rivers, and even a tranquil cruise through the beautiful Chesapeake Bay.

And as a cherry on top, there’s a special treat waiting for you in Washington, D.C. This cruise will allow small ships to dock closer to the national monuments for the first time in over 70 years. Imagine the history and beauty right at your fingertips!

More Unique Options to Choose From

Ready for some history? You might be interested in the “Civil War Battlefields Cruise 2026,” a captivating 36-day excursion from New Orleans to Gettysburg, scheduled from May 5 to June 9, 2026. This journey will take you through 12 states while visiting important Civil War sites. It’s a great way to combine a love for travel with an understanding of American history.

Luxury Aboard Small Ships

No matter which itinerary you choose, rest assured that you’ll be gliding through your journey aboard the luxurious small ships of American Cruise Lines. Expect spacious staterooms and diverse dining options, all tailored for your comfort. Plus, your cruise will include daily excursions, expert-led experiences, and a dedicated cruise concierge to cater to your every need.

Excited to embark on this grand adventure? Reservations are already open for these unique travel experiences! Pricing for the “Great United States Cruise” starts at $45,645 per person, with a $5,000 deposit required to secure your spot on this unforgettable journey.
